Hamilton gets replacement set of tyres for race
Lewis Hamilton will be given a replacement set of tyres for the start of the European Grand Prix, following approval from the FIA to change the ones he damaged in qualifying. The world champion flat-spotted the set of tyres on which he set his fastest time in Q2, which were in theory the ones he was supposed to start the race on. But with the set being damaged – and potentially unsafe – the FIA was asked to inspect the tyres to work out if they could be replaced.
